Interviews capture surprising insights into Laymon's life and craft. Within these pages, Laymon talks about his engagement with other writers, including Richard Wright, William Faulkner, and Eudora Welty. These revelations situate his memoir, \u003ci\u003eHeavy\u003c\/i\u003e, among other great Mississippi autobiographies and memoirs, such as Anne Moody's \u003ci\u003eComing of Age in Mississippi\u003c\/i\u003e, Welty's \u003ci\u003eOne Writer's Beginnings\u003c\/i\u003e, Jesmyn Ward's \u003ci\u003eMen We Reaped\u003c\/i\u003e, and Natasha Trethewey's \u003ci\u003eMemorial Drive\u003c\/i\u003e. In other interviews, he discusses his obsession with revision and deftly fields questions about pop culture, politics, and Black masculinity, along with a host of other pressing contemporary issues. \u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e As the first collection of its kind, \u003ci\u003eConversations with Kiese Laymon \u003c\/i\u003eserves as the perfect introduction to studying Laymon. The cross section of interviews included reflects Laymon's humility, while simultaneously celebrating his accomplishments. Most importantly, the interviews reflect his stature as a major American literary figure.
